Apple's Final Cut Pro and Logic Pro Are Coming to iPad
The apps have new touch interfaces that allow users to enhance their workflows with Multi-Touch.
Apple has announced it is bringing Final Cut Pro and Logic Pro to iPad so video and music creators can "unleash their creativity" in new, comfortable ways.
The apps offer new touch interfaces that allow you to improve your workflows with Multi-Touch.
Final Cut Pro for iPad introduces a set of tools for video creators to record, edit, finish, and share. Logic Pro for iPad puts the power of professional music creation in the hands of the creator with a complete collection of tools for songwriting, beat making, recording, editing, and mixing.
Final Cut Pro for iPad
Apart from the new interface, the tool introduces a new jog wheel that allows you to navigate the Magnetic Timeline, move clips, and make fast frame-accurate edits with just the tap of a finger. Live Drawing lets you draw and write directly on top of video content using Apple Pencil. Additionally, on iPad Pro with M2, Apple Pencil hover makes you quickly skim and preview footage without touching the screen.
Moreover, the app brings a pro camera mode to adjust footage, and multicam video editing enables synchronizing and editing clips as well as switching angles.
Other features include the Scene Removal Mask, which removes or replaces the background behind a subject without using a green screen, Auto Crop to adjust footage for different aspect ratios, and Voice Isolation, which removes background noise from audio captured in the field.
Logic Pro for iPad
Its Plug-in Tiles makes it easy to quickly shape sounds. You can capture voice or instrument recordings with the built-in mics on iPad and turn any space into a recording studio with five studio-quality mics on iPad Pro.
The new sound browser uses dynamic filtering to help you discover what you need. It displays all available instrument patches, audio patches, plug‑in presets, samples, and loops in a single location.
Logic Pro offers over 100 instruments and effects plug-ins including Sample Alchemy – a new sample manipulation instrument that can transform any audio sample.
Other tools include a beat-making plug-in, Quick Sampler, Step Sequencer, and Drum Machine Designer. What's more, Live Loops allows you to build arrangements by mixing and matching musical loops.
Final Cut Pro and Logic Pro for iPad will be available on the App Store starting May 23. They will be distributed through a monthly subscription for $4.99 or a yearly subscription for $49.
